| SAG Strain Number: | 1195-1 |
| TAXONOMY |
| Genus: | Vacuolaria |
| Species: | virescens |
| Taxonomic position: | Heterokontophyta - Raphidophyceae |
| Authority: | Cienkowski |
| Variety: | |
| Formerly called: | |
| Authentic: | no |
| Division: | Heterokontophyta |
| Class: | Raphidophyceae |
| ORIGIN |
| General habitat: | freshwater |
| Climatic zone: | |
| Continent: | Europe |
| Country: | United Kingdom |
| Locality: | Cheshire, Wirral, loamy pond on sandstone at Thurstaston |
| Lat. / Long. (Precision): | 53.350612 / -3.133593 (500m) View on Google Maps |
| Year: | 1949 |
| Isolated by: | E.G. Pringsheim |
| Strain number by isolator: | |
| Deposition by: | E.G. Pringsheim (SAG) |
| Deposition date: | 1954 |
| CULTURE INFORMATION |
| Culture medium: | MiEB12 |
| Axenic: | bacterial or other types of contamination |
| Strain relatives: | UTEX 2237 |
| Agitation resistance: | not detected |
| Special properties: | NO known Nagoya Protocol restrictions for this strain |
